Overview

H11 CYTOSHELL is a Bio-Systems logistics platform for laboratories, hospitals, field teams, and biotech programs that move sensitive biological material under strict traceability requirements.

What It Does

It stabilizes sample environments, records transport conditions, isolates material from handling disturbances, and creates an auditable record for review when biological material arrives.

How It Works

A sealed inner capsule sits inside a thermal and mechanical protection shell. Embedded sensors record temperature, vibration, orientation, time, and access events, while the custody layer preserves the transfer history.
